SBI arrests former Madison Co. chief deputy for criminal activity involving inmates, staff

MADISON COUNTY, N.C. (WLOS) — The North Carolina State Bureau of Investigation has announced that it has arrested the former Madison County Sheriff’s Deputy.

According to a social media post, the SBI announced the arrest of Madison County Sheriff’s Chief Deputy, Bronis Coy Phillips, on multiple felony and misdemeanor charges following alleged criminal activity involving inmates and detention facility staff.
